The Bright Room

The Bright Room Sensory Room

The Bright Room sensory room is a bookable space run by the Chelsea Foundation, designed to support those with sensory needs, anxiety, and similar disabilities.


The capacity of this room is a maximum of 10 supporters and 2 specially trained members of staff.


Booking

To book or get more information please contact the Chelsea Foundation inclusion and disability team at:


foundation.enquiries@chelseafc.com

The entrance to the East Lower stand concourse.

Accessing The Bright Room

Accessibility

The Bright Room is accessed via the East Stand lower tier concourse. 


Firstly, enter via the Stamford Gate entrance. 


Follow the stadium round to the right side - this will lead you to the ramp for the East Stand lower concourse.


Once at the top of the ramp, continue along the tunnel. 


A sign for The Bright Room hangs from the ceiling, alongside the entrance, which is on the left.


A sign is on the wall next to the entrance saying The Bright Room.


Entry

No ticket is required but confirmation of booking may be needed for stewards on the way to The Bright Room.

Inside The Bright Room

Facilities

The Bright Room aesthetic is fittingly football themed. 


A mat which replicates a football pitch, with green flooring to match. 


Football beanbags, next to a window to the Stamford Bridge pitch.


Royal blue mats, beanbags and sensory lighting to represent our Chelsea colours.


A football boot and a match ball are amongst the sensory touch items available.


Toilets

There is an accessible toilet within the room.

Quiet Spaces

Kingsmeadow

Kingsmeadow has a newly renovated quiet space based in the south-west corner of the stadium, next to the accessible toilet. 


This capacity of this space is 2 adults, an adult with a child or a wheelchair user. 


This space is suitable for those with sensory needs, breast feeding mothers and for praying.


Supporters cannot watch the game from the quiet room and require a match ticket to enter the ground.


There is a steward on the door and stewards within the stadium can help with escorting from other stands within the stadium. 


Booking

To book in advance please contact: 


disabilityteam@chelseafc.com 


or speak to a steward on the day.
